Marine biologist Micheline Jenner lives at sea on her boat RV Whale Song, and has spent more than twenty years immersing herself in the world of whales, conducting world-first research into their life cycles, their movements and their all-important breeding grounds.
Here, she collects her insights from her work with humpback, blue and pygmy blue whales in particular, taking us from Australia to Antarctica and beyond as she follows them and studies their behaviour. Enlightening and eye-opening, The Secret Life of Whales reveals fascinating information about whales, tapping into Jenner's wealth of scientific knowledge and infectious love for these magnificent creatures.
